The future VH-TFA in a Fokker publicity photo. It is carrying the name of Dutch explorer Dirk Hartog. The aircraft remained in the Netherlands for pilot training and it became the second TAA F27 to arrive in Australia after VH-TFB. On arrival in Australia in June 1959 , -TFA's name was changed to Charles Todd. This photo was added on 20 February 2022, and has since been viewed 491 times. |
